Technical architecture and programme schedule145. GALILEO architecture has been designed to meet <str<strong>on</strong>g>the</str<strong>on</strong>g> service needs explained above. TheGALILEO <strong>global</strong> comp<strong>on</strong>ent, comprising <str<strong>on</strong>g>the</str<strong>on</strong>g> c<strong>on</strong>stellati<strong>on</strong> <str<strong>on</strong>g>of</str<strong>on</strong>g> 27 active <strong>satellite</strong>s, plus three inorbitpassive spare <strong>satellite</strong>s <strong>on</strong> three orbital planes in Medium Earth Orbit and its associatedground segment, will broadcast <str<strong>on</strong>g>the</str<strong>on</strong>g> signals in space required to achieve <str<strong>on</strong>g>the</str<strong>on</strong>g> so-called <strong>satellite</strong>-<strong>on</strong>lyservices. The ground segment includes two c<strong>on</strong>trol centres, a network <str<strong>on</strong>g>of</str<strong>on</strong>g> uplink stati<strong>on</strong>s, sensorstati<strong>on</strong>s and a GALILEO communicati<strong>on</strong>s network.146. The regi<strong>on</strong>al comp<strong>on</strong>ents are foreseen to independently provide integrity to GALILEO incertain regi<strong>on</strong>s, in additi<strong>on</strong> to <str<strong>on</strong>g>the</str<strong>on</strong>g> <strong>global</strong> integrity service.147. These GALILEO <strong>satellite</strong>-<strong>on</strong>ly services can be enhanced locally with <str<strong>on</strong>g>the</str<strong>on</strong>g> help <str<strong>on</strong>g>of</str<strong>on</strong>g> localelements that may be deployed for extra accuracy or integrity around airports, harbours, railheadsand in urban areas. C<strong>on</strong>sequently, <str<strong>on</strong>g>the</str<strong>on</strong>g> <strong>global</strong> comp<strong>on</strong>ent will be designed from <str<strong>on</strong>g>the</str<strong>on</strong>g> start so as toeasily interface with <str<strong>on</strong>g>the</str<strong>on</strong>g>se elements.148. In <str<strong>on</strong>g>the</str<strong>on</strong>g> same way, <str<strong>on</strong>g>the</str<strong>on</strong>g> interoperability between GALILEO and external comp<strong>on</strong>ents willbe a major driver <str<strong>on</strong>g>of</str<strong>on</strong>g> <str<strong>on</strong>g>the</str<strong>on</strong>g> GALILEO design to allow for <str<strong>on</strong>g>the</str<strong>on</strong>g> development <str<strong>on</strong>g>of</str<strong>on</strong>g> applicati<strong>on</strong>sembedding or combining GALILEO services and external <strong>systems</strong> services (e.g. navigati<strong>on</strong> orcommunicati<strong>on</strong> <strong>systems</strong>, mobile ph<strong>on</strong>es).149. For example, <str<strong>on</strong>g>the</str<strong>on</strong>g> combined use <str<strong>on</strong>g>of</str<strong>on</strong>g> GALILEO and GPS standard positi<strong>on</strong>ing service willresult in a 95% availability <str<strong>on</strong>g>of</str<strong>on</strong>g> <strong>satellite</strong> signals in an urban envir<strong>on</strong>ment. For comparis<strong>on</strong>, relying<strong>on</strong> GPS <strong>on</strong>ly gives today a 55% availability.150. Interoperability, added performance, safety, new applicati<strong>on</strong>s and wider use <str<strong>on</strong>g>of</str<strong>on</strong>g> <str<strong>on</strong>g>the</str<strong>on</strong>g>technology are key factors in <str<strong>on</strong>g>the</str<strong>on</strong>g> definiti<strong>on</strong> and development <str<strong>on</strong>g>of</str<strong>on</strong>g> GALILEO.151. The GALILEO programme involves <str<strong>on</strong>g>the</str<strong>on</strong>g> following phases:• Development and in-Orbit validati<strong>on</strong> (2003-2005);• Deployment (2006-2007); and• Operati<strong>on</strong>s (from 2008).152. The definiti<strong>on</strong> phase has been completed earlier. The manufacturing <str<strong>on</strong>g>of</str<strong>on</strong>g> <str<strong>on</strong>g>the</str<strong>on</strong>g> <strong>satellite</strong>s and<str<strong>on</strong>g>the</str<strong>on</strong>g> related ground segment and launching <str<strong>on</strong>g>of</str<strong>on</strong>g> <str<strong>on</strong>g>the</str<strong>on</strong>g> first <strong>satellite</strong>s will be completed during <str<strong>on</strong>g>the</str<strong>on</strong>g>Development and In-Orbit Validati<strong>on</strong> Phase. This phase is co-funded by EC and ESA. The cost<str<strong>on</strong>g>of</str<strong>on</strong>g> developing and deploying <str<strong>on</strong>g>the</str<strong>on</strong>g> system, including <str<strong>on</strong>g>the</str<strong>on</strong>g> launch <str<strong>on</strong>g>of</str<strong>on</strong>g> 30 <strong>satellite</strong>s and commissi<strong>on</strong>ing<str<strong>on</strong>g>of</str<strong>on</strong>g> <str<strong>on</strong>g>the</str<strong>on</strong>g> ground infrastructure is 3.4 billi<strong>on</strong> Euros.153. The GALILEO Joint Undertaking is an enterprise that has overseen <str<strong>on</strong>g>the</str<strong>on</strong>g> programimplementati<strong>on</strong> since September 2003 and is preparing <str<strong>on</strong>g>the</str<strong>on</strong>g> grounds for <str<strong>on</strong>g>the</str<strong>on</strong>g> deployment <str<strong>on</strong>g>of</str<strong>on</strong>g>infrastructure.154. The first two experimental GALILEO <strong>satellite</strong>s are currently being built so as to retain<str<strong>on</strong>g>the</str<strong>on</strong>g> priority allocated when <str<strong>on</strong>g>the</str<strong>on</strong>g> frequencies were applied for within <str<strong>on</strong>g>the</str<strong>on</strong>g> ITU.155. In <str<strong>on</strong>g>the</str<strong>on</strong>g> deployment phase <str<strong>on</strong>g>the</str<strong>on</strong>g> private sector will c<strong>on</strong>tribute through a c<strong>on</strong>cessi<strong>on</strong> scheme toensure <str<strong>on</strong>g>the</str<strong>on</strong>g> user-orientati<strong>on</strong> <str<strong>on</strong>g>of</str<strong>on</strong>g> GALILEO services.
